Transaction 42821181324b75e155a9bae2b734136c918c21748570b8f1522f02d3d16b85fa

1 Input
2 Outputs
  • 42821181324b75e155a9bae2b734136c918c21748570b8f1522f02d3d16b85fa:0
  • value  2116334643
    address  2NFeR2wcLWcPijU3H87gXLTii6EgpWsManH
  • 42821181324b75e155a9bae2b734136c918c21748570b8f1522f02d3d16b85fa:1
  • value  1972011
    address  2NDWX7Rz4ZVbu8ouCHw34369URZriAWTmrS